Our team has looked into improving the Stelo <> Levels integration, but, unfortunately, the delay is due to Dexcom restricting how data is sent to Apple Health. Levels can pull in glucose data through Apple Health, but the Stelo app has a built in 3hr delay that we're unable to bypass.
